Server IP : 180.180.241.3 / Your IP : 216.73.216.252 Web Server : Microsoft-IIS/7.5 System : Windows NT NETWORK-NHRC 6.1 build 7601 (Windows Server 2008 R2 Standard Edition Service Pack 1) i586 User : IUSR ( 0) PHP Version : 5.3.28 Disable Function : NONE MySQL : ON | cURL : ON | WGET : OFF | Perl : OFF | Python : OFF | Sudo : OFF | Pkexec : OFF Directory : /Program Files/MySQL/MySQL Workbench 6.3 CE/structs/ |
Upload File : |
<?xml version="1.0"?> <gstructs xmlns:attr="http://www.mysql.com/grt/struct-attribute"> <requires file="structs.db.xml"/> <requires file="structs.xml"/> <gstruct name="db.mysql.Catalog" parent="db.Catalog"> <members> <member name="logFileGroups" type="list" content-type="object" content-struct-name="db.mysql.LogFileGroup" overrides="db.LogFileGroup" owned="1"/> <member name="tablespaces" type="list" content-type="object" content-struct-name="db.mysql.Tablespace" overrides="db.Tablespace" owned="1"/> <member name="serverLinks" type="list" content-type="object" content-struct-name="db.mysql.ServerLink" overrides="db.ServerLink" owned="1"/> <member name="schemata" type="list" content-type="object" content-struct-name="db.mysql.Schema" overrides="db.Schema" owned="1"/> </members> </gstruct> <gstruct name="db.mysql.Schema" parent="db.Schema" attr:caption="MySQL Schema"> <members> <member content-struct-name="db.mysql.Table" content-type="object" name="tables" overrides="db.Table" type="list" owned="1" attr:editas="hide"/> <member content-struct-name="db.mysql.View" content-type="object" name="views" overrides="db.View" type="list" owned="1" attr:editas="hide"/> <member content-struct-name="db.mysql.Routine" content-type="object" name="routines" overrides="db.Routine" type="list" owned="1" attr:editas="hide"/> <member content-struct-name="db.mysql.RoutineGroup" content-type="object" name="routineGroups" overrides="db.RoutineGroup" type="list" owned="1" attr:editas="hide"/> <member content-struct-name="db.mysql.Synonym" content-type="object" name="synonyms" overrides="db.Synonym" type="list" owned="1" attr:editas="hide"/> <member content-struct-name="db.mysql.StructuredDatatype" content-type="object" name="structuredTypes" overrides="db.StructuredDatatype" type="list" owned="1" attr:editas="hide"/> <member content-struct-name="db.mysql.Sequence" content-type="object" name="sequences" overrides="db.Sequence" type="list" owned="1" attr:editas="hide"/> </members> </gstruct> <gstruct name="db.mysql.LogFileGroup" parent="db.LogFileGroup" attr:caption="MySQL Log File Group"> <members> <member name="engine" type="string" attr:desc = "usually only NDB makes sense"/> <member name="nodeGroupId" type="int" attr:desc = "a unique id for the group, used in a tablespace"/> <member name="wait" type="int" attr:desc = "no documentation yet"/> </members> </gstruct> <gstruct name="db.mysql.Tablespace" parent="db.Tablespace" attr:caption="MySQL Tablespace"> <members> <member name="engine" type="string" attr:desc = "NDB and InnoDB are supported"/> <member name="nodeGroupId" type="int" attr:desc = "the same id as used for a logfile group"/> <member name="wait" type="int" attr:desc = "no documentation yet"/> </members> </gstruct> <gstruct name="db.mysql.ServerLink" parent="db.ServerLink" attr:caption="MySQL Server Alias"/> <gstruct name="db.mysql.PartitionDefinition" parent="GrtObject" attr:caption="Table Partition Definition"> <members> <member name="value" type="string"/> <member name="comment" type="string"/> <member name="dataDirectory" type="string"/> <member name="indexDirectory" type="string"/> <member name="maxRows" type="string"/> <member name="minRows" type="string"/> <member name="tableSpace" type="string"/> <member name="engine" type="string"/> <member name="nodeGroupId" type="int"/> <member name="subpartitionDefinitions" type="list" content-type="object" content-struct-name="db.mysql.PartitionDefinition" owned="1"/> </members> </gstruct> <gstruct attr:caption="MySQL Table" name="db.mysql.Table" parent="db.Table"> <members> <member name="primaryKey" type="object" struct-name="db.mysql.Index" overrides="db.Index" attr:caption="Primary Key" attr:editas="hide"/> <member name="columns" type="list" content-type="object" content-struct-name="db.mysql.Column" overrides="db.Column" attr:caption="Columns" owned="1" attr:editas="hide"/> <member name="indices" type="list" content-type="object" content-struct-name="db.mysql.Index" overrides="db.Index" attr:caption="Indices" owned="1" attr:editas="hide"/> <member name="foreignKeys" type="list" content-type="object" content-struct-name="db.mysql.ForeignKey" overrides="db.ForeignKey" attr:caption="Foreign Keys" owned="1" attr:editas="hide"/> <member name="triggers" type="list" content-type="object" content-struct-name="db.mysql.Trigger" overrides="db.Trigger" owned="1" attr:caption="Triggers" attr:editas="hide"/> <member name="tableEngine" type="string" attr:editas="hide"/> <member name="nextAutoInc" type="string" attr:editas="numeric" attr:dontdiff="2"/> <member name="password" type="string" attr:editas="hide"/> <member name="delayKeyWrite" type="int" attr:editas="bool"/> <member name="defaultCharacterSetName" type="string" attr:editas="hide"/> <member name="defaultCollationName" type="string" attr:editas="hide"/> <member name="mergeUnion" type="string" attr:editas="hide"/> <member name="mergeInsert" type="string" attr:editas="hide"/> <member name="tableDataDir" type="string"/> <member name="tableIndexDir" type="string"/> <member name="packKeys" type="string" attr:editas="hide" attr:desc = "DEFAULT, 0 or 1"/> <member name="raidType" type="string" attr:editas="hide"/> <member name="raidChunks" type="string" attr:editas="hide"/> <member name="raidChunkSize" type="string" attr:editas="hide"/> <member name="checksum" type="int" attr:editas="hide"/> <member name="rowFormat" type="string" attr:editas="hide"/> <member name="keyBlockSize" type="string" attr:editas="hide"/> <member name="avgRowLength" type="string" attr:editas="hide"/> <member name="minRows" type="string" attr:editas="hide"/> <member name="maxRows" type="string" attr:editas="hide"/> <member name="connection" type="object" struct-name="db.ServerLink" owned="1" attr:caption="Server Link" attr:desc="if this is a federated table the connection is set to the server link object" attr:editas="hide"/> <member name="connectionString" type="string" attr:desc="if this is a federated table the connection is set to the server link object" attr:editas="hide"/> <member name="partitionType" type="string" attr:editas="hide"/> <member name="partitionExpression" type="string" attr:editas="hide" attr:desc = "a generic expression or a column list"/> <member name="partitionKeyAlgorithm" type="int" attr:editas="hide" attr:desc = "algorithm used for KEY partition type, can be 1 or 2"/> <member name="partitionCount" type="int" attr:editas="hide"/> <member name="subpartitionType" type="string" attr:editas="hide"/> <member name="subpartitionKeyAlgorithm" type="int" attr:editas="hide" attr:desc = "algorithm used for KEY partition type, can be 1 or 2"/> <member name="subpartitionExpression" type="string" attr:editas="hide"/> <member name="subpartitionCount" type="int" attr:editas="hide"/> <member name="partitionDefinitions" type="list" content-type="object" content-struct-name="db.mysql.PartitionDefinition" owned="1" attr:editas="hide"/> <member name="statsAutoRecalc" type="string" attr:editas="hide" attr:desc = "DEFAULT, 0 or 1"/> <member name="statsPersistent" type="string" attr:editas="hide" attr:desc = "DEFAULT, 0 or 1"/> <member name="statsSamplePages" type="int" attr:editas="hide"/> <member name="tableSpace" type="string" attr:editas="hide"/> </members> </gstruct> <gstruct name="db.mysql.Column" parent="db.Column"> <members> <member name="autoIncrement" type="int"/> <member name="generated" type="int" attr:desc = "0 or 1, 1 if generated column" /> <member name="expression" type="string" attr:desc = "The full expression for a generated column as text" /> <member name="generatedStorage" type="string" attr:desc = "VIRTUAL or STORED, for generated columns only" /> </members> </gstruct> <gstruct name="db.mysql.SimpleDatatype" parent="db.SimpleDatatype"/> <gstruct attr:caption="MySQL Structured Datatype" name="db.mysql.StructuredDatatype" parent="db.StructuredDatatype"/> <gstruct name="db.mysql.Index" parent="db.Index"> <members> <member name="indexKind" type="string" attr:desc="one of BTREE, RTREE and HASH"/> <member name="keyBlockSize" type="int"/> <member name="withParser" type="string"/> <member name="algorithm" type="string" attr:desc = "one of DEFAULT, INPLACE and COPY"/> <member name="lockOption" type="string" attr:desc = "one of DEFAULT, NONE, SHARED and EXCLUSIVE"/> <member name="columns" type="list" content-type="object" content-struct-name="db.mysql.IndexColumn" overrides="db.IndexColumn" owned="1"/> </members> </gstruct> <gstruct name="db.mysql.IndexColumn" parent="db.IndexColumn"/> <gstruct name="db.mysql.ForeignKey" parent="db.ForeignKey"> <members> <member name="referencedTable" type="object" struct-name="db.mysql.Table" overrides="db.Table"/> </members> </gstruct> <gstruct name="db.mysql.Trigger" parent="db.Trigger" attr:caption="MySQL Trigger"/> <gstruct name="db.mysql.Event" parent="db.Event" attr:caption="MySQL Event"/> <gstruct attr:caption="MySQL View" name="db.mysql.View" parent="db.View"/> <gstruct attr:caption="MySQL Routine Group" name="db.mysql.RoutineGroup" parent="db.RoutineGroup"/> <gstruct attr:caption="MySQL Routine" name="db.mysql.Routine" parent="db.Routine"> <members> <member name="security" type="string" attr:editas="hide"/> <member name="returnDatatype" type="string" attr:editas="hide"/> <member attr:caption="Parameters" content-struct-name="db.mysql.RoutineParam" content-type="object" name="params" type="list" owned="1" attr:editas="hide"/> </members> </gstruct> <gstruct name="db.mysql.RoutineParam" parent="GrtObject"> <members> <member name="datatype" type="string"/> <member name="paramType" type="string"/> </members> </gstruct> <gstruct attr:caption="MySQL Synonym" attr:desc="a MySQL synonym object" name="db.mysql.Synonym" parent="db.Synonym"/> <gstruct attr:caption="MySQL Sequence" attr:desc="a MySQL database sequence object" name="db.mysql.Sequence" parent="db.Sequence"/> <gstruct attr:caption="MySQL Storage Engine Option" attr:desc="an option description for a MySQL storage engine" name="db.mysql.StorageEngineOption" parent="GrtNamedObject"> <members> <member name="caption" type="string"/> <member name="description" type="string"/> <member name="type" type="string"/> </members> </gstruct> <gstruct attr:caption="MySQL Storage Engine Type" attr:desc="a MySQL storage engine type description" name="db.mysql.StorageEngine" parent="GrtNamedObject"> <members> <member name="caption" type="string"/> <member name="description" type="string"/> <member name="supportsForeignKeys" type="int"/> <member attr:caption="Options" content-struct-name="db.mysql.StorageEngineOption" content-type="object" name="options" type="list" owned="1"/> </members> </gstruct> </gstructs>